Which TWO of the following are typically included in the fieldwork phase of an IS audit? (Select two.)

Testing controls

Fieldwork involves executing audit procedures; walkthroughs and testing controls are part of fieldwork.

Answer analysis

Option-by-option breakdown

For each option: why learners choose it and why it is or isn't the right answer here.

  • Defining audit scope

    Why it's wrong here

    Defining scope is part of planning.

  • Testing controls

    Why this is correct

    Testing controls is a fieldwork activity.

  • Developing the audit program

    Why it's wrong here

    Developing the audit program is part of planning.

  • Issuing the draft report

    Why it's wrong here

    Issuing the draft report is part of reporting.

  • Performing walkthroughs

    Why this is correct

    Walkthroughs are performed during fieldwork.
